Rf. Wang et al., SYNTHESIS, CRYSTAL-STRUCTURE AND LUMINESC ENCE OF COORDINATION COMPOUND OF EUROPIUM P-METHYLBENZOATE WITH 2,2'-DIPYRIDINE, Huaxue xuebao, 53(1), 1995, pp. 39-45
The coordination compound of europium p-methylbenzoate with 2,2 '-dipy
ridine was synthesized and characterized by elemental analysis and inf
rared spectrum. The crystal structure of the title compound, Eu-2(p-MB
A)(6)(dipy)(2) (p-MBA: p-methylbenzoate, dipy: 2,2 '-dipyridine) was d
etermined by the X ray diffraction analysis. It crystallizes in the mo
noclinic C2/c system with unit cell dimensions a=1.4086(6), b=1.9115(1
1), c=2.3077(16)nm; beta=96.60(4)degrees, V=6.1727nm(3) and Z=4. The m
etal atoms are octa-coordinated with the bidentates of p-methylbenzoat
e and 2,2 '-dipyridine. Since the title coordination compound Eu(p-MBA
), dipy fluoresces very intensely under ultraviolet or visible light.
Using Eu(III) ion as luminescent probe, the high-resolution laser exci
ted excitation and luminescence spectra and time resolved spectra were
recorded at 77K. The emission spectra indicate that two Eu(III) ion s
ites are present in the compound .
